                The Foundation

The Alachua County Library
District Foundation was
incorporated in 1989 as a
501(C)(3)) organization to seek
private funds for the Alachua
County Library District.

Although tax revenues support
the library’s on-going operations-
core collections, staffing and
maintenance of equipment-                        Headquarters Library
supplemental funding is needed              Alachua County Library District

to ensure the library’s long-term
stability.

        •Assists the library with development projects.
        •Focuses on securing major gifts and bequests.

  The Library Endowment
           Fund

 The primary goal of the Foundation
   is to build a one-million dollar
      Library Endowment Fund.

 The Endowment is a perpetual fund
 •    the principal is invested
 •    interest is available annually

 The Endowment keeps growing and
provides a stable source of funding especially
   during ups and downs of the economy.

         Katherine’s Tree

Katherine’s Tree is a ten foot high
“donor tree” located at the
Headquarters Library in downtown
Gainesville.

The Tree is an etched-glass
rendition of the Tree of Knowledge
surrounded by an impressive oak
frame and base.

Each leaf represents an endowment
gift of $2,000 or more. A leaf often
commemorates a birthday,
anniversary or other special
occasion.

Katherine’s Tree is named for Katherine Ann Tubb (1976 -1991), a
young woman who, during her brief life, was an avid reader and
library user. Katherine Ann Tubb was the daughter of Gainesville
                                                                   5
residents, George and Marilyn Tubb.
